Technical Considerations and Quality Checks
While the design is strong, no graphic asset is perfect without proper preparation. Before committing to a full production run, I always recommend a rigorous testing phase. Here are the critical steps I take to ensure quality control:
- Check SVG Line Cleanliness: Open the vector file in your cutting software. Look for stray nodes or overlapping paths that could cause the blade to stutter or cut incorrectly. A clean line art structure is non-negotiable for professional results.
- Verify PNG Transparency: If you are using the PNG version for sublimation or digital printing, zoom in to 400%. Check the edges for jagged pixels or white halos. A transparent background must be flawless to blend naturally onto colored substrates.
- Test on Real Mockups: Digital screens can be deceiving. Print a test copy on the actual material you plan to sell. Does it look too heavy? Too sparse? Adjust the size and placement accordingly. Sometimes, simplifying the layout by removing minor details improves readability on smaller products.
- Color Contrast Testing: Test the design against various backgrounds. A black silhouette might disappear on a dark navy shirt unless you add a white outline. Conversely, it pops brilliantly on cream-colored mugs. Always confirm how it looks on both white and dark products to avoid returns due to visibility issues.
Typography and Styling Pairings
A great graphic needs great typography to complete the message. With Mother Son Sitting on Bench Silhouette, the choice of font can shift the entire mood of the product. For a classic, timeless look, pair the silhouette with a serif font. This combination suggests elegance and tradition, suitable for formal greeting cards or upscale home decor.
For a more approachable, friendly vibe, try a sans-serif font. This works well for modern t-shirt designs and casual sticker packs. If you want to emphasize the personal, handmade aspect, consider a script or handwritten font. This adds a human touch, reinforcing the idea that the product was made with care. However, avoid overly decorative display fonts that compete with the artwork; let the silhouette remain the focal point.
